Technical Breakdown

“Shores of Gold” in Sea of Thieves excels in its captivating graphics and realistic water physics. The environment renders with intricate detail, featuring lush islands, vibrant coral reefs, and shimmering ocean surfaces. The water physics system allows for dynamic ship and wave interactions, creating a natural and immersive gameplay experience.

Performance Insights

The game’s performance remains stable on most systems, with minimal frame drops or loading times. The game engine effectively utilizes multithreading to distribute the workload, resulting in smooth gameplay and consistent frame rates. The optimization allows for high-quality graphics without compromising the performance.

Technical Challenges

However, “Shores of Gold” faces some technical challenges. Balancing the graphical fidelity with performance is crucial, and some players may experience occasional stuttering or FPS drops. Additionally, the game’s reliance on cloud-based saving can lead to connectivity issues or data loss in unreliable network environments.
